Yeah it's the same as the Civic Si Sedan. In Canada cause we sometimes get different models of Acura's than the States, they decided to offer a CSX Type S instead of a 4dr Civic Si Sedan.
- sport tuned suspension
- LED brakelights
- recessed fog lights
- 17' aluminum-alloy rims
- 2.0 i-VTEC (197hp) motor with Helical LSD
- Vehicle Stability Assist (VSA)
- Leather wrapped seats with Type S emboosed on the seats
- Satellite Linked Navigation System with Voice Recognition
- 350watt stereo system with digital audio card reader.....etc, etc, etc..
and all the other useless options.....
